1
resposta

[Dúvida] Desafio: o uso do let

Fiz os meus desafios, mas na hora que fui corrigir, vi que em alguns começavam com o “let” e outros não. Por que isso? Qual é a regra? ( Os exemplos abaixo são do GitHub da Alura)

diaDaSemana = prompt('Qual é o dia da semana?'); if (diaDaSemana == 'Sábado') { alert('Bom fim de semana!'); } else if (diaDaSemana == 'Domingo') { alert('Bom fim de semana!'); } else { alert('Boa semana!'); }


let nome = prompt('Qual o seu nome?'); alert(Boas vindas ${nome});

1 resposta

Oi, Manulli. Tudo bem?

Estranho, pois o código

diaDaSemana = prompt('Qual é o dia da semana?');

deveria ter um let antes. Só não teria se já tivesse sido declarado antes. Verifica se nos código acima não foi declarado essa variável diaDaSemana sem valor.